The Versatility of Winter sweaters

Winter sweaters are a staple in many wardrobes, offering both warmth and style during the colder months. With various materials, designs, and fits available, these garments can be easily paired with different outfits for any occasion. From chunky knits to lightweight pullovers, there’s a sweater for everyone.

One of the most popular materials for winter sweaters is wool. Known for its excellent insulation properties, wool keeps you warm without adding bulk. Additionally, cashmere sweaters provide a luxurious feel and unparalleled softness, making them a favorite among fashion enthusiasts. These materials not only keep you cozy but also elevate your winter wardrobe.

Color and pattern choices play a significant role in the versatility of winter sweaters. Classic neutrals like gray, black, and beige serve as great layering options, while bold colors and festive patterns add a fun twist to your winter ensemble. Whether you prefer a timeless cable knit or a trendy oversized style, there’s no shortage of options to express your personal style.

Styling Tips for Winter Sweaters

Layering is key when it comes to styling winter sweaters. Pairing a sweater with a collared shirt underneath adds an extra dimension to your look while providing additional warmth. For a more casual vibe, you can wear your sweater over a simple t-shirt, allowing for easy transitions from indoor to outdoor settings.

Accessorizing your winter sweater can take your outfit to the next level. A statement necklace or a stylish scarf can add flair and draw attention to your sweater. Additionally, incorporating different textures—such as pairing a knitted sweater with leather pants or a denim skirt—can create a visually interesting ensemble that stands out.

Footwear also plays a crucial role in completing your winter sweater look. Ankle boots, knee-highs, or even chic sneakers can complement your outfit depending on the occasion. Choosing the right shoes not only enhances your overall style but also ensures comfort during those chilly winter days.

Proper care is essential to maintain the quality and longevity of your winter sweaters. Always check the care label for specific washing instructions, as different materials may require different methods. Hand washing or using a gentle cycle in cold water is often recommended for delicate fabrics like wool and cashmere.

When storing your sweaters, it’s best to fold them instead of hanging to prevent stretching. Keeping them in a cool, dry place will help avoid moth damage and preserve their shape. For added protection, consider using breathable garment bags or cedar blocks to keep pests at bay.

Regularly pilling is a common issue with sweaters, especially those made from natural fibers. Invest in a fabric shaver to gently remove pills and maintain a polished appearance. By following these simple care tips, you can ensure that your winter sweaters remain a beloved part of your wardrobe for years to come.
